G. Patrick is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, G. Patrick has authored 40 papers receiving a total of 770 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, 7 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and 5 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in G. Patrick's work include Inhalation and Respiratory Drug Delivery (15 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(4 papers) and Occupational exposure and asthma (4 papers). G. Patrick is often cited by papers focused on Inhalation and Respiratory Drug Delivery (15 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(4 papers) and Occupational exposure and asthma (4 papers). G. Patrick coll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Germany and France. G. Patrick's co-authors include D.G. Papworth, Sentaro Takahashi, Kingman P. Strohl, M. D. Altose, D.T. Goodhead, Loren Cobb, B.M. Cattanach, E. V. Hulse, A.L. Batchelor and V Im Hof and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, The Journal of Physiology and Environmental Health Perspectives.
